Practice Round:
Competitors are kindly granted courtesy of the course for one practice round prior to the championship. Practice times are available after 13.00 on Saturday 27 July. On Sunday 28 July practice will be available between 09.00 and 17.00. Competitors unable to practice on Saturday 27 or Sunday 28 July may arrange an alternative time by prior arrangement with the club. Bookings for practice times must be made in advance by telephoning on 01250 872622 (option 2).

The official practice rounds will be played from the championship tees.

NB: Demand for practice times on Sunday 28 July is expected to be extremely high therefore competitors local to Blairgowrie Golf Club are respectfully asked and encouraged to utilise the practice times on Saturday 27 July.

Additional practice rounds will be charged at £15.00.

Practice Facilities:
Competitors may use the club’s practice ground at Carsie and must practice from within the designated hitting area. There will be balls supplied at the range for competitors.
PRACTICE BALLS MUST NOT BE REMOVED FROM THE RANGE UNDER ANY CIRCUMSTANCES. ANY PLAYER FOUND GUILTY OF THIS ACTION WILL BE LIABLE TO DISCIPLINARY ACTION BY THE CHAMPIONSHIP COMMITTEE.

There is a short game area and practice putting green near the clubhouse, which is 220 yards long where 8 bays are available. Balls at this area will be charged at £1 for bucket of 25.

The practice ground will be open 45 minutes before the first tee off time on all championship days. Practice ground hours of operation will be posted at the Championship Office and at the Driving Range Office.

Competitors using any of the above practice facilities do so at their own risk.

Registration:
Competitors must report to the Championship Office a minimum of 30 minutes prior to the first round tee off time.

Each competitor will be issued with a copy of the local rules, pin positions, pace of play guidelines and bag tag when registering at the Championship Office.

Course and Play:
Competitors must report to the official starter at the first tee five minutes before they are due to play.

Caddies are permitted for the duration of the Championship.

When a match is over, play must stop and the winner report the result of the match to the Championship Office without undue delay.

Pace of Play:
Players will be required to read the SGU pace of play guidelines prior to registering at the Championship Office. Full guidelines are also available on the SGU 2013 Rules hard card.

The SGU Pace of Play Policy will be implemented for the duration of the championship with roving referees on course to enforce any necessary actions.

Withdrawals:
Withdrawals will not be accepted at any time unless confirmed by email, fax or letter. A competitor failing to notify SGUL by this method before 17:00 on Friday 26 July will be subject to an automatic ban of up to two years from all SGUL events. Only in exceptional circumstances and on formal appeal to the Championship Committee will the ban be lifted.

A player is not permitted to withdraw at any stage of the championship except for emergency reasons or medical circumstances explained to and deemed acceptable by the Championship Committee. A player failing to notify the Championship Committee in person of his withdrawal before departing the championship venue will be subject to an automatic ban of up to two years from all SGUL events. Only in exceptional circumstances and on formal appeal will the ban be lifted.

Car Park:
Competitors may use the main car park with an overflow available if required. The Scottish Golf Union and Blairgowrie Golf Club cannot accept responsibility for any damage to cars.

Catering:
Coffee, tea and morning rolls will be available from 06.15 for first three days of the Championship and from 07.15 thereafter. Food will be served all day with last orders 10-15 minutes after close of play each day. A limited menu will be in place for the duration of the championship. All catering is at the competitor's own expense.

Clubhouse:
The clubhouse will be open one hour before the first tee-time on each day. Competitors, their families and guests are permitted the use of the clubhouse facilities.

In all clubhouse areas and on the course casual wear is acceptable for competitors, but must be smart. THE WEARING OF JEANS, DENIM TROUSERS, SLEEVELESS OR COLLARLESS SHIRTS, TRACK SUITS AND TRAINING SHOES IS NOT PERMITTED. Hats must be removed before entering the Clubhouse. Golf shoes are prohibited in the lounge and restaurant.

Competitors under 18 years of age shall not be allowed to purchase alcoholic drinks.

MOBILE PHONES MUST BE SWITCHED OFF IN THE CLUBHOUSE.

Changing facilities are available in the Gents locker rooms. There are lockers available, which are coin operated, for the storage of small bags. There are showers available however competitors are advised to bring their own towel.

Trolleys and Yardage Books:
The professional’s shop has a limited number of trolleys for hire on a first come first serve basis. Yardage books are also available for purchase at £3.50.

Insurance:
The entry fee includes cover in respect of competitors' legal liability in the event of injury to another person or damage to a third party property. An excess will apply.

Presentation:
Bronze medals will be presented to the losing semi-finalists at the close of play on Friday 2 August. The championship trophy and finalist medals will be presented at the close of play on Saturday 3 August. Medal winners are expected to attend the relevant prize giving.
